About This Book
What if you could explore the wildest places on Earth and meet animals that live there? Imagine discovering how amphibians, birds, fish, reptiles, and mammals survive in these extreme homes. But can these creatures teach us their secrets before the adventure ends?

Animals at the Extremes introduces young readers to a variety of animal types, including amphibians, birds, fish, reptiles, and mammals, highlighting their similarities and differences. Written for early readers aged 5 to 8, this fiction book uses simple language to engage children in learning about animal adaptations in extreme environments. It is appropriate for young audiences and contains no content concerns.
